Your Path, Your Pace!

 It's easy to fall into the trap of comparing your progress to others, especially when it feels like everyone around you is ahead. But it's important to remember: Don't compare your chapter 1 to someone else's chapter 15 and don't compare your beginning to someone's middle. Everyone's journey is different, and your path is uniquely yours.

Comparing yourself to others, particularly those who seem further along, can often lead to feelings of inadequacy and discouragement. But the truth is, everyone's journey is different. People start at different points, have varying experiences, and progress at their own pace. Just because someone else is further along doesn’t diminish your progress.

It’s essential to embrace your own timeline. Instead of focusing on what others have achieved or where they are in their journey, take a moment to celebrate your own milestones no matter how big or small. Your achievements matter, and each step forward is worth recognizing.

Remember, use others as inspiration, not comparison. You can admire the accomplishments of others, but they are not the measure of your own worth or success. Learn from their experiences, but allow their journey to motivate you, not make you feel inadequate.

Finally, be kind to yourself. Self-compassion and self-acceptance are key to maintaining a healthy perspective. Treat yourself with the same kindness and understanding that you would offer to others, recognizing that you, too, are on your own unique path, progressing at your own pace. Your journey is yours to define, and you are exactly where you need to be.

Remember, your journey is not a race, and there's no timeline that defines your worth. Embrace your own progress, trust in your path, and celebrate the unique journey that is unfolding for you. Keep moving forward with confidence, knowing that every step you take is a meaningful part of your personal growth. Trust that, in time, your persistence will lead you exactly where you're meant to be.
